#f5162f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f5162f is composed of 96.1% red, 8.6%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91% magenta, 80.8%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 353.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 52.4%. #f5162f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c5e with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

Shades and Tints of #f5162f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0002 is the darkest color, while #fff8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5162f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e7d7f is the less saturated color, while #fe0d28 is the most saturated one.
